Java项目框架是Java编程中非常重要的一部分,它可以帮助开发者更快、更高效地完成项目。在这个快速发展的技术时代,掌握Java项目框架不仅能够提高开发效率,还能让你在职场中更具竞争力。本文将为你揭秘Java项目框架的入门知识,以及一些实战技巧,让你轻松提升开发效率。
Java项目框架概述
1. 什么是Java项目框架?
Java项目框架是指在Java编程语言中,为解决特定问题或实现特定功能而提供的一系列预定义的代码和库。这些框架通常包含了一系列的工具和组件,可以简化开发过程,提高代码质量。
2. Java项目框架的特点
- 提高开发效率:框架提供了一套标准化的开发流程和工具,可以大大减少开发时间和工作量。
- 代码质量:框架遵循一定的编码规范和设计模式,有助于提高代码的可读性和可维护性。
- 降低成本:框架可以复用代码,降低项目成本。
Java项目框架入门
1. Java项目框架分类
Java项目框架可以分为以下几类:
- Web框架:如Spring MVC、Struts、Hibernate等,用于开发Web应用程序。
- 企业服务框架:如Spring Boot、MyBatis、Dubbo等,用于构建企业级应用程序。
- 移动开发框架:如Android SDK、iOS SDK等,用于开发移动应用程序。
2. 入门步骤
- 选择合适的框架:根据项目需求和自身熟悉程度,选择一个合适的框架。
- 学习框架文档:阅读框架的官方文档,了解其功能和用法。
- 实践操作:通过实际操作,掌握框架的基本使用方法。
Java项目框架实战技巧
1. 遵循设计模式
设计模式是解决特定问题的通用解决方案,可以帮助你编写更优秀的代码。在Java项目框架中,常用的设计模式有:
- 单例模式:确保一个类只有一个实例,并提供一个访问它的全局访问点。
- 工厂模式:根据不同的条件创建相应的对象实例。
- 观察者模式:当一个对象的状态发生变化时,通知所有依赖该对象的对象。
2. 利用缓存技术
缓存技术可以加快数据查询速度,提高应用程序的性能。在Java项目框架中,常用的缓存技术有:
- Redis:一个开源的内存数据结构存储系统,可以用作缓存。
- Memcached:一个高性能分布式内存对象缓存系统。
3. 关注安全性
在开发过程中,要时刻关注安全性问题。以下是一些提高Java项目框架安全性的技巧:
- 使用安全的编码规范:遵循安全编码规范,减少代码漏洞。
- 防范SQL注入:使用预编译语句或ORM框架来防止SQL注入攻击。
- 使用HTTPS:确保数据传输的安全性。
总结
掌握Java项目框架对于Java开发者来说至关重要。通过本文的介绍,相信你已经对Java项目框架有了更深入的了解。在实际开发中,不断实践和积累经验,你将能够更好地运用Java项目框架,提高开发效率。
